Identifying Wasp Nests
To determine wasp nests, carefully observe your environments and search for distinctive physical features that suggest their presence. One crucial sign is the presence of wasps flying in and out of a specific location. Take note of locations such as eaves, rooflines, and tree branches, where wasps frequently build their nests.
Try to find structures made of paper-like product, which is a typical structure material for wasp nests. These structures can differ in size, varying from tiny, golf ball-sized nests to bigger, basketball-sized nests.
Furthermore, watch out for wasp task during the daytime, as they're most energetic throughout daytime hours. By carefully observing these physical features and actions, you can effectively identify the existence of wasp nests in your environments.
Safe and Effective Wasp Nest Removal
When handling the visibility of a wasp nest, it is very important to understand exactly how to securely and properly remove it. Right here are some professional strategies to aid you with secure wasp nest removal:
- ** Protective Clothing **: Always wear safety clothes, such as long sleeves, trousers, handwear covers, and a beekeeping veil, to protect on your own from possible stings.
- ** Nighttime Removal **: Wasps are less energetic at night, so it's best to eliminate the nest after sunset when they're much less likely to be hostile.
- ** Using Pesticide **: Apply a pesticide specifically made for wasp nest removal. Spray it straight onto the nest, covering the entire surface area.
Avoiding Wasp Nests in the Future
To stop future wasp nests, take positive steps to get rid of attractants around your building. Start by securing any type of splits or openings in your walls, home windows, and doors to avoid wasps from going into and developing nests.
Maintain your trash bin snugly secured and routinely deal with food waste to stay clear of bring in wasps. In addition, remove any kind of potential nesting sites by routinely evaluating and preserving your residential property. Trim tree branches, bushes, and shrubs that might provide an ideal area for wasps to build their nests.
Stay clear of leaving standing water or exposed food and drinks outside, as this can also attract wasps. By taking these positive actions, you can dramatically decrease the chance of future wasp nests and delight in a wasp-free atmosphere.
